VPS额外IP的使用指南,提升服务器性能的秘密武器
卡尔云官网
www.kaeryun.com
在VPS(虚拟专用服务器)的使用过程中,很多人可能会疑惑:除了主IP之外,为什么还要配置额外的IP地址?额外IP的使用并不是高大上的配置,而是一种非常实用的技术手段,可以帮助你更好地管理服务器资源,提升网站的稳定性。
什么是VPS额外IP?
VPS额外IP,就是你可以在同一台服务器上注册多个IP地址,每个IP地址都可以绑定不同的域名,指向同一个VPS服务器,这样,当你有一个高流量的网站时,可以通过将访问量分散到多个IP上,避免单个IP被过度消耗,从而延长服务器的可用时间。
举个例子,假设你的主IP是120.234.567.com,如果你的网站流量突然激增,可能需要在120.234.567.com上增加额外的IP地址,比如180.234.567.com和240.234.567.com,这样,当120.234.567.com被攻击或需要维护时,其他IP仍然可以正常运行,确保网站的稳定性和可用性。
为什么需要额外IP?
在VPS服务器中,资源是有限的,比如CPU、内存、磁盘空间和带宽,如果你只有一个IP地址,而你的网站流量突然激增,可能会导致服务器资源被耗尽,甚至出现故障,而通过配置额外IP,你可以将流量分散到多个IP上,从而更好地利用服务器资源。
额外IP还可以帮助你实现负载均衡,通过将访问量分配到多个IP上,你可以避免单个IP被过度使用,从而延长服务器的使用寿命,如果你的网站需要高可用性,比如电商网站或在线服务,额外IP还可以帮助你避免主IP被攻击,从而确保网站的正常运行。
如何获取额外IP?
获取额外IP的方法有很多种,以下是一些常见的方法:
使用云服务提供商的API
如果你使用的是公有云服务提供商(比如AWS、Azure、Google Cloud等)提供的VPS服务,大多数云服务提供商都会提供API,允许你获取额外的IP地址,Google Cloud提供了GetExtraIpAddress
API,你可以通过调用这个API来获取额外的IP地址。
使用第三方DNS解析服务
除了公有云服务提供商的API,还有许多第三方DNS解析服务可以提供额外的IP地址,Namecheap、GoDaddy、HostGator等公司都提供DNS记录解析服务,你可以通过这些服务获取额外的IP地址。
自托管
如果你不想依赖第三方服务,也可以自己托管额外的IP地址,你可以通过以下步骤获取额外的IP:
- 获取你的VPS服务器的域名(比如example.com)。
- 使用一个域名解析工具(比如Google Domains、Namecheap等),将域名example.com解析到一个额外的IP地址,比如120.234.567.com。
- 将这个额外的IP地址添加到你的域名注册商(registrar)的记录中,这样当你注册新的域名时,可以指定不同的IP地址。
配置额外IP的步骤
一旦你获取了额外的IP地址,接下来的步骤就是如何将它们配置到你的VPS服务器中。
添加域名到域名解析工具
你需要将你的VPS服务器的域名(比如example.com)添加到域名解析工具中,这样,当你注册新的域名时,可以指定不同的IP地址。
设置DNS记录
你需要设置DNS记录,将你的域名example.com指向额外的IP地址,你可以将example.com指向120.234.567.com、180.234.567.com和240.234.567.com。
配置VPS服务器
你需要在VPS服务器的配置中,将域名example.com指向额外的IP地址,这样,当你访问example.com时,就会被自动重定向到额外的IP地址。
额外IP的潜在问题及解决方案
在使用额外IP时,可能会遇到一些问题,比如DNS解析失败、资源分配不均、安全问题等,以下是一些常见的问题及解决方案:
DNS解析失败
如果某个额外的IP地址的DNS记录解析失败,可能导致访问该IP时出现问题,解决方案是检查DNS记录,确保记录正确,并尝试更换DNS解析服务。
资源分配不均
如果你的VPS服务器资源有限,可能会出现某些IP地址的负载远高于其他IP地址,解决方案是调整负载均衡策略,或者升级VPS服务器的资源。
安全问题
额外IP地址可能成为攻击目标,尤其是在主IP地址被攻击时,解决方案是启用安全组,限制来自外部的流量,确保额外IP的安全。
为什么使用额外IP很重要?
使用额外IP可以让你更好地管理服务器资源,避免单个IP被过度使用,从而延长服务器的使用寿命,额外IP还可以帮助你实现高可用性,确保网站在面对攻击或维护时依然能够正常运行。
如果你的网站需要高并发访问,使用额外IP可以更好地分配流量,避免服务器资源被耗尽,如果你的网站流量大,或者需要高可用性,使用额外IP是一个非常实用的配置。
VPS额外IP的使用并不是高大上的配置,而是一种非常实用的技术手段,通过配置额外IP,你可以将流量分散到多个IP上,从而更好地利用服务器资源,提升网站的稳定性,如果你的网站流量大,或者需要高可用性,使用额外IP是一个非常值得尝试的配置。
希望这篇文章能够帮助你理解VPS额外IP的使用方法,以及它在网站管理中的重要性,如果你有任何关于VPS的其他问题,欢迎随时提问!
卡尔云官网
www.kaeryun.com